Habilitando SSL no JBoss AS 7.1

Postado em Atualizado em

Hoje vamos aprender como habilitar SSL no JBoss AS 7.

Vamos armazenar o .keystore no diretório configuration da nossa instância.

   cd JBOSS_HOME/standalone/configuration/

Agora execute:

   keytool -genkey -alias example -keystore example.keystore -keypass 123456 -keyalg RSA

Preencha as informações do certificado, conforme a sua necessidade.

Adicione o ao JBOSS_HOME/standalone/configuration/standalone.xml , as configurações abaixo no subsystem web.

<connector name="https" protocol="HTTP/1.1" scheme="https" socket-binding="https">
   <ssl name="ssl" key-alias="example" password="123456" certificate-key-file="../standalone/configuration/example.keystore"/>
</connector>

Abra o navegador de sua preferência e verifique a  url https://localhost:8443/ .

O  SSL está habilitado.

Espero que tenha ajudado.
Abraços!

JBoss: jboss-as-7.1.0.CR1b
Fonte: https://docs.jboss.org/author/display/AS7/HTTPS+Connectors

3 comentários em “Habilitando SSL no JBoss AS 7.1

    Luan Gil de Azevedo disse:
    30 de janeiro de 2013 às 14:29

    Boa tarde Mauricio,
    Achei o artigo muito bom, fiz as configurações e meu computador e tudo funciona normalmente porem quando subo a aplicação e o standalone para o servidor da http://www.integrator.com.br não consigo acessar com https, somente com http.

    você tem alguma idéia do que pode ser ?

    Obrigado

      Mauricio Magnani Jr respondido:
      30 de janeiro de 2013 às 15:52

      Oi Luan Boa tarde,
      No servidor da integrator vc tem um apache na frente ou está tentando acessar um JBoss diretamente?
      Se for diretamente no JBoss talvez a porta esteja bloqueada impedindo o seu acesso. Verifique se está aberta a porta 8443 no Firewall da Integrator.

      Abs

        Mauricio Magnani Jr respondido:
        30 de janeiro de 2013 às 15:54

        Sei que talvez já tenha pensado nisso mas até meu me esqueço as vezes por ser tão básico rsrs

        Se não for isso me diz se ocorre algum erro ou exception…

        Abs

Deixe uma resposta

Preencha os seus dados abaixo ou clique em um ícone para log in:

Logotipo do WordPress.com

Você está comentando utilizando sua conta WordPress.com. Sair / Alterar )

Imagem do Twitter

Você está comentando utilizando sua conta Twitter. Sair / Alterar )

Foto do Facebook

Você está comentando utilizando sua conta Facebook. Sair / Alterar )

Foto do Google+

Você está comentando utilizando sua conta Google+. Sair / Alterar )

Conectando a %s